If you own a new vehicle, losing your key will most likely mean that you'll need to have a transponder key replaced. These keys, which are commonly found in vehicles that are relatively new, use a chip to work with a computer unlock doors and disable the car if you forget your keys. While they are more secure than conventional keys and can cost up to $320 to replace, smart keys may be more difficult to use.
